.product-reviews{padding:var(--reviews-padding-top, 64px) 0 var(--reviews-padding-bottom, 64px)}.product-reviews__inner{max-width:var(--page-width, 1400px);margin:0 auto;padding:0 24px}.product-reviews__heading{font-family:var(--font-heading-family);font-size:clamp(1.8rem,3vw,2.6rem);font-weight:500;font-style:italic;color:rgb(var(--color-foreground));margin:0 0 8px;text-align:center}.product-reviews__summary{text-align:center;margin-bottom:48px;display:flex;flex-direction:column;align-items:center;gap:6px}.product-reviews__avg-stars{display:flex;gap:3px}.product-reviews__avg-text{font-family:var(--font-body-family);font-size:11px;letter-spacing:.1em;text-transform:uppercase;color:rgb(var(--color-foreground));opacity:.6;margin:0}.product-reviews__star{color:rgba(var(--color-foreground),.15)}.product-reviews__star--on{color:rgb(var(--color-foreground))}.product-reviews__grid{display:grid;grid-template-columns:repeat(3,1fr);gap:1px;background:rgba(var(--color-foreground),.1);border-top:.5px solid rgba(var(--color-foreground),.15);border-bottom:.5px solid rgba(var(--color-foreground),.15)}.product-reviews__card{background:rgb(var(--color-background));padding:32px 28px;display:flex;flex-direction:column;gap:12px}.product-reviews__stars{display:flex;gap:2px}.product-reviews__card-title{font-family:var(--font-heading-family);font-size:1.1rem;font-weight:500;font-style:italic;color:rgb(var(--color-foreground));margin:0;line-height:1.3}.product-reviews__card-body{font-family:var(--font-body-family);font-size:13px;line-height:1.75;color:rgb(var(--color-foreground));opacity:.8;margin:0;flex:1}.product-reviews__card-footer{display:flex;flex-direction:column;gap:3px;padding-top:12px;border-top:.5px solid rgba(var(--color-foreground),.12);margin-top:auto}.product-reviews__author{font-family:var(--font-body-family);font-size:11px;font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:rgb(var(--color-foreground))}.product-reviews__location{font-family:var(--font-body-family);font-size:10px;letter-spacing:.06em;color:rgb(var(--color-foreground));opacity:.5}.product-reviews__product-tag{font-family:var(--font-body-family);font-size:10px;letter-spacing:.08em;text-transform:uppercase;color:rgb(var(--color-foreground));opacity:.45;margin-top:2px}@media(max-width:989px){.product-reviews__grid{grid-template-columns:1fr 1fr}}@media(max-width:599px){.product-reviews__grid{grid-template-columns:1fr;background:transparent;border:none}.product-reviews__card{border-bottom:.5px solid rgba(var(--color-foreground),.12);padding:28px 0}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/section-product-reviews.css.map */
